温馨提示×

Linux清理策略:哪些文件可以安全删除

小樊
135
2025-04-30 12:18:06
栏目: 智能运维

在Linux系统中,有许多文件是可以安全删除的,但需要谨慎操作以避免误删重要文件。以下是一些常见的可以安全删除的文件类型:

临时文件

  1. /tmp/

    • 这个目录通常用于存储程序运行时产生的临时文件。
    • 可以使用rm -rf /tmp/*命令来清空,但要注意不要删除正在使用的文件。
  2. /var/tmp/

    • 类似于/tmp/,但它的生命周期更长,重启后可能仍然存在。
  3. ~/.cache/

    • 用户缓存文件夹,包含浏览器、应用程序等的缓存数据。
    • 可以使用rm -rf ~/.cache/*命令清理。
  4. ~/.local/share/Trash/

    • 回收站中的文件,可以手动清空或使用系统自带的清理工具。

日志文件

  1. /var/log/

    • 包含系统和应用程序的日志信息。
    • 可以定期清理旧的日志文件,例如使用logrotate工具。
  2. /var/log/syslog

    • 系统日志文件,通常会自动轮转。
  3. /var/log/auth.log

    • 认证相关的日志。

包管理器缓存

  1. Debian/Ubuntu:

    • /var/cache/apt/archives/
    • 可以使用sudo apt-get clean命令清理。
  2. Red Hat/CentOS:

    • /var/cache/yum/
    • 可以使用sudo yum clean all命令清理。

浏览器缓存

  • 清理浏览器(如Chrome、Firefox)的缓存文件夹。

过期软件包和依赖

  1. Debian/Ubuntu:

    • 使用sudo apt-get autoremove命令删除不再需要的依赖包。
  2. Red Hat/CentOS:

    • 使用sudo yum autoremove命令。

用户临时文件

  • ~/.bash_history
    • 可以备份后删除,或者使用history -c清空当前会话的历史记录。

其他有用的清理工具

  • BleachBit

    • 一个图形化的系统清理工具,可以清理缓存、临时文件、日志等。
  • System Cleaner

    • 另一个图形化工具,提供一键清理功能。

注意事项

  • 在删除任何文件之前,最好先确认它们的用途和重要性。
  • 使用rm命令时要加上-i选项进行交互式确认,以防止误删。
  • 定期备份重要数据,以防万一需要恢复。

总之,合理使用上述方法和工具,可以在不影响系统正常运行的前提下,有效地清理不必要的文件,释放磁盘空间。

0